RE: Proposed Amendment No. 6 to Water Service Contract with Charter Township of Harrison

MOTION

Upon recommendation of Randal Brown, General Counsel, the Board of Directors ("Board") of the Great Lakes Water Authority ("GLWA"), authorizes the Chief Executive Officer ("CEO") to execute Amendment No. 6 to the 30-year water service contract with Charter Township of Harrison; and authorizes the CEO to take such other action as may be necessary to accomplish the intent of this vote.
BACKGROUND
On 12/14/2020, the Harrison Township ("Member Partner") Board agreed to the terms of Amendment No. 6 ("Amendment") to the Water Service Contract with GLWA.

As set forth in the attached Exhibit B, GLWA and the Member Partner agreed to increase the maximum day and peak hour values for calendar year 2021 and beyond. No other contract values are modified by this Amendment.

Additionally, this Amendment updates Exhibit A of the contract, which establishes the Member Partner's service area boundaries, meter locations, emergency connections, those retail customers outside of the Member Partner's corporate limits, and each party's respective ownership and maintenance responsibilities. Exhibit A is not attached for homeland security reasons.


JUSTIFICATION
Approval of this Amendment provides a mutually beneficial, stable, long-term framework for interactions between GLWA and the Member Partner and incorporates annual system planning volumes, pressures, and maximum day and peak hour values that better reflect future Member Partner usage.
